This course introduces learners to the full range of subsidiary motions, including motions to amend, postpone, refer to a committee, and more. Learners will explore each motion’s rank in the order of precedence, its standard descriptive characteristics, and how to apply these motions to real meeting scenarios. The course also compares how these motions are treated in different parliamentary authorities such as RONR and AIPSC.
